Jayden Ross competes way too hard for the way that some of you guys are talking about him. He has flaws, especially offensively, but he’s in over his head because the roster needs him to be.

He’s probably our best wing defender, generally attacks the glass pretty hard, had some good contests at the rim as help side defender, and didn’t turn the ball over. Obviously he can’t have 40/22/66 shooting splits forever, but the reason he plays is because we need SOMEBODY who can guard. Swain was making a lot of noise in the first half and Ross is a big reason he didn’t continue to.

Posting up Tarris consistently disrupts our normal offense because we need our center to screen for our shooters. If he can prove he can stay on the floor, maybe that trade off would be worth it. As it is, he had 4 fouls in 11 minutes, against a team who doesn’t play anyone bigger than 6’9. Except for the Butler OT game, he’s been fouling at a higher rate than Samson.

Samson has also been much better recently and has had double figures in 4 of the last 7 games.

This mirrored the Memphis game:

We and Xavier shot the same # FGs and made the same. We out rebounded them, out assisted them out blocked them, and other stats were comparable except fouls and free throws. We continue to foul with our bigs reaching in, or their best athlete goes 1:1 on AK who just cannot handle.

There was a nice stretch in the 2nd half with Mahaney and Ball and Diarra driving and getting fouls on Xavier - we kind of gave up on that but it showed that we can get their bigs into foul trouble too.
